MALIBU, Calif. -- The No. 17 University of San Diego men's tennis team (15-4, 5-0 WCC) stay hot in league play as they defeated the No. 41 Pepperdine Waves (11-8, 3-2 WCC) Wednesday evening at the Ralphs-Straus Tennis Center. Although the Waves stayed close in singles play, the Toreros edged them out 4-1. The Toreros stay on track sustaining their undefeated record against West Coast Conference opponents.
The Toreros remained dominant in doubles play quickly picking up the first point at the No. 2 spot. Juniors Romain Kalaydjian and Uros Petronijevic cruised past Waves' Pedro Imamachkine and Tom Hill 6-2. Pepperdine managed to equalize the score after senior Ciaran Fitzgerald and sophomore Geoffrey Fosso dropped their first league match at the No. 3 spot. No. 43-ranked junior Jordan Angus and sophomore Filip Vittek came up clutch for the Toreros once again securing the point with a 6-3 victory. The pair are 10-3 in dual season play.
Angus, who recently earned WCC Player of the Week honors, lived up to the title. Angus picked up the first singles point of the day, marking his seventh singles victory in a row and defeating Waves' Rakshay Thakkar 6-3, 6-2. While Kalaydjian dropped a two-set decision at the No. 4 spot, Fosso answered -- picking up a victory over Pepperdine's Luca Marquard 6-3, 6-3. No. 57 Vittek clinched the match for the Toreros, narrowly ousting Waves' Stefan Menichella 7-6(3), 7-5.
The remaining matches at the No. 1 and 6 positions stopped play in third sets.
"Every match these guys surprise me," Head coach Brett Masi said. "They want to show everyone that they deserve to be where we are. It can get a little crazy at Pepperdine to play and the guys handeled it well - handled the pressure well. I think all the tough, away matches we have had so far really paid off. This was the best road match I've seen the guys play. This was the first time I've ever won here, also grabbing my 100th win. There's a lot of people to thank for that. I am veyr proud of the guys. Even though we were the better team it's always nice to beat the Waves."
The Toreros stay at home this weekend and celebrate Senior Day. The Toreros will honor lone senior Ciaran Fitzgerald this Saturday, April 4th, at 1:00 p.m. -- PT against the St. Mary's Gaels.
